Several systemic cardiovascular (CV) risk assessment algorithms exist, of which the ESC HeartScore, Framingham and PROCAM are the most frequently applied in Germany. The risk estimates generated differ and take a number of different risk factors into consideration. Due to existing homology of retinal vessels and brain vessels, eye fundus examination is a promising approach to improving risk prediction. Large cohort studies investigated retinal vascular changes, including arteriovenous ratio, as well as signs of retinopathy such as cotton-wool spots, microaneurysms, or retinal hemorrhages for their ability to predict systemic cardiovascular events. While signs of retinopathy proved to have high predictive power (but are rarely diagnosed,) the retinal vascular changes investigated could contribute little to enhancing systemic CV risk prediction. A number of new and promising approaches based on static and dynamic retinal analysis exist, but still need to be validated prospectively.Entities:
